Filter & Sort
District
( Selected)
AND
Places
( Selected)
AND
Option
( Selected)
Dietary restrictions
OR
Cuisine
( Selected)
OR
Dish
( Selected)
OR
Type
( Selected)
AND
Amenities
( Selected)
AND
Services
( Selected)
AND
Special Menu
( Selected)
AND
Atmosphere
( Selected)
Time
( Selected)
Budget
( Selected)
Sort By

Top Pizza Shop

Report inappropriate review or replies

Top Pizza Shop
240 Avenue de l'Equinoxe

You work here? Click here to learn about our marketing tools.

"Gave this place a chance as they are a new business and wanted to support local While the flavors were honestly pretty good, I just can't get over the fact that every single slice was a different size. I had never seen or been served different size slices from a New York style pizza. How does that even work? Every client pays the same price but..."

Your Message